The Role:




  • Exhibits strong technical underwriting skills through strategic, thorough account reviews and file documentation

  • Grows and maintains profitable book of business through execution of individual risk underwriting and adherence to the strategic plan of the unit

  • Stays current on competition, underwriting environment, and market conditions and share that knowledge with colleagues and leadership

  • Develops and executes marketing plan aimed at retaining existing business and producing new opportunities

  • Travels to and completes marketing/sales meetings in assigned territories within the southeast region

  • Exhibits good understanding of pricing components and rating methodology; prices risk based on financial and competitive analysis

  • Prepares or analyzes information on adverse underwriting decisions, rate appeals, underwriting requirements, status and declinations in order to drive results within the assigned territory

  • Monitors production, profitability and maintains agency relationships

  • Effectively communicates (written/verbal) information to both internal and external customers to ensure our standards of excellence are maintained

  • Ensures underwriting and service standards are met on assigned accounts

  • Reviews profitability of each account on a quarterly basis in a strong, auditable condition



The Requirements:



  • Minimum of 3-7 years of experience
  • Proven underwriting track record
  • Strong retail broker relationships
  • Knowledgeable of the financial institutions, real estate, hospitality, construction, professional services, leisure, retail and distribution industries
  • Experience underwriting Property, General Liability, Workers’ Compensation, Commercial Automobile, and Excess Casualty
  • Ability to multi-task and prioritize workflows efficiently
  • Professional demeanor in language, writing, and presentation skills
  • Experience with Microsoft Office
